The Youthcare studio felt it was necessary to research youth homelessness to better understand and serve our clients. We quickly found that youth homelessness is the result of many profoundly complex societal problems, the majority starting with the family but spanning to global economics.
Despite historical initiatives and legislature passed at the federal and state levels, youth homelessness remains a serious issue. With the onset of the 2008 recession, youth homelessness has increased dramatically. The primary cause for this increase is the inability of a financially struggling family to support their older children. In addition, neglect, abuse, residential instability, and family conflict are large contributors to youth homelessness. Furthermore, unemployment, crime, limited funding, and a lack of access to education, support, and resources continually perpetuates the homelessness of youth.
The services and organizations that do exist, like Youthcare, are always at capacity and working hard to take care of the day to day. However, many of these organizations are also looking to innovate their approaches to the larger patterns of youth homlessness. One innovation that we looked at is the “Foyer model”.

The Foyer model approaches youth homelessness by focusing on the assets and energy of the youth in order to support and facilitate a transition to independence. Foyers provide housing, education, and training in exchange for a commitment to support the community through their behavior and work. In many cases the buildings and the services they provide become a beacon and landmark in the area and help bring the youth out of the shadows and into society.

YOUTH HOMELESSNESS - TRANSITIONAL HOUSING
Housing strategies for homeless youth include:-Group Homes-”Housing First” or rapid re-housing: prioritized by King County-Permanent supportive housing-Employment-focused housing-Transitional housing: short term, typically 18-24 month. It is intended to bridge between living on the street or in emergency shelters to permanent, stable housing. The concept of transitional housing began in the early 1990s and it has expanded ever since. In 2004, over 7,000 transitional housing programs existed.

“To be successful, housing must be enhanced with intensive case management services, school, meals, job training, and money management and other life skills training.” - City of Seattle
Important to the success of any housing program are:-issues of scale-level of independence vs. support-community networks-fit within the fabric of the local community-safety and stability
Gaps in services:-funding for programs typically ends at age 24, making support and resources scarce for young adults who are unable to live independently-there is a bottleneck of facilities and staff that limits the number of youth able to enter-much of the transitional housing available requires sobriety
Local services:-King County receives $19 million in annual funding for its “Continuum of Care” through the McKinney Vento Homesless Assisstance Act-King County has a “10 Year Plan to End Homelessness” that proposes new dormitory style housing for youth and young adults-Housing providers in the Seattle area (focus area indicated): Archdiocesan Housing Authority (women), Cedar House (mental illness), Church Council of Greater Seattle’s Home Step (low-income stable), Dove House, Friends of Youth’s New Ground (transitional), Goodwill Development Association’s Aridell Mitchell Home (transitional), ROOTS (emergency shelter), United Indians of All Tribes, Urban League of Metropolitan Seattle’s Harder House (transitional group home), YMCA Young Adult Services (transitional and permanent), and YouthCare.

The New Horizon Youth Centre is an organization that assists youth in the transition to adulthood. The youth centre addition adds a series of spaces to an existing youth homeless shelter. Different configurations of seating and surfaces allow for different levels of privacy and sociability. Window nooks or group seating tables reiterate the available choice in experience. Several elements are made out of solid materials in order to express permanence and durability.
Privacy nookStudy area Exterior view Creative Expression Space
The architects were focused on avoiding institutional space by creating a sense of home and flexibility. A space on the top floor acts as a place for intense expression or emotion. It is clad in slightly shifting wooden planes in order to express warmth and security.

The headquarters for Outside In is a 31,000 square foot building that contains counseling services, employment services, a clinic, kitchen, dining space, and housing.
The design for the main headquarters of Outside In was focused on making the building approachable. This goal was accomplished by breaking up the building in different sections and expressing each one differently. Other approachable elements include the exposed structure, the angled walls, and “urban materials.” The mural and street art further ensures a non-institutional building.
Entrance Dynamic massing of building facade Entrance atrium Entry outdoor space
The courtyard creates a private outdoor space for the youth while also allows the opportunity to be opened up to the public. For the interior of the building, a two-story lobby acts as the internal, central hub of the building.

Gray water - any used water that is carrying a very low amount of organic material. This includes water from bathroom sinks, washing machines, and showers.
Black water - water from kitchen sinks and toilets is considered black water because it likely carries a lot of organic solids and must be more extensively treated and or filtered. This is the most difficult to treat on-site.
Rain water - As a rule of thumb, each inch of rainwater will provide .55 gallons of water per sq.ft. of roof1” rain = .55gallons/sq.ft. of roof
Seattle average annual rainfall: 38”
Yesler Site12,980 sq ft x 38“ rain/year x .55 = 271,282 gal/ year
Daily indoor per capita water use is 69.3 gallons.
Installing more efficient fixtures can lower daily per capita water usage to 45.2 gallons (saving 35%).
40 youth at 45.2 gallons per day: 650,000 gallons per year10 staff at 10 gallons per day: 25,000 gallons per year
Total indoor building usage: 675,000 gallons per yearDoes not include outdoor usage

IntroductionWorkshop GoalsAs part of our research, we conducted two sets of workshops with the managers and staff of YouthCare, and the youth at the Orion Center.
These workshops consisted of collaborative exercises to get ideas and feedback from the youth and staff regarding how they view their current space, and what they would want in a
Managers and Staff at Workshop 1
new space. Another goal was to understand the relationships between staff and youth at the different levels of housing, and see how those relationships affect the physical space they occupy. This feedback was very valuable for us as we developed our projects.
We also discussed design/build ideas for our studio, as well as opportunities for future work with YouthCare.
Workshop 1 Introduction Board
Managers and Staff at Workshop 1
Virginia and Erin running Workshop 1
Workshop 1: What works, what doesn’t? focused primarily on identifying the current benefits, drawbacks, strengths, and weaknesses of the YouthCare homes and centers.
Workshop 2: Ideas for the future featured a dot exercise to identify priorities and a board game to stimulate conversation about function proximities and relationships.

IntroductionWorkshop Findings
The following questions and answers represent the cumulative knowledge of the managers, staff, and youth.
Managers and Staff Dot Exercise at Workshop 2
Where do the youth like to spend most of the their time inside? Why?The different residential settings facilitate different kinds of hanging out. Some managers said the youth prefer the living room and dining rooms, and smoking areas, while others said the youth prefer spending time in their bedrooms, and hang out in the laundry room. Some managers noted that this was because they simply just did not have a good gathering space. When it is nice outside, the youth like to be on the front porches. The youth at the Orion Center liked spending time playing video games on the couches.
Where do the staff like to spend time inside, or would like to spend time, and why?The staff also like to hang out in the kitchen, and at the administrative offices. They voiced opinions that they need to have a space that is dedicated to a gathering space, because being in the offices is disruptive to those working.
What is your favorite thing about the building you work in? Least favorite?Favorite things included: the old houses have character, outside patios, individual rooms for residents, front porch, built-in benches, commercial kitchen at Orion Center, flexible spaces can have many uses.Least favorite things included: old houses need a lot of maintenance, lack of studio apartments, lack of office space, lack of game room/common space, shared office space, no place to eat/lack of common space for staff, no “decompression” space for staff, and not enough small meeting rooms. IntroductionWhat spaces are best, or would be best, for interacting with the youth in a professional capacity?The offices and small meeting rooms - but many are shared and do not allow for the needed privacy. Outdoor spaces are also good.
What spaces are best, or would be best, for interacting with the youth socially?Similarly, outdoor spaces are good for social interaction, as are the kitchens, and it’s also really good to have offices on public corridors - it facilitates interactions. Social living spaces, such as living rooms, would be good. Small individual counseling spaces are also good for social interactions.
What is the outdoor space like at your place of work? Does it work well or poorly? What would your ideal outdoor space be like for a new YouthCare facility that combined housing, counseling, offices, education, and training programs?In general, the managers agreed that having programmed outdoor space, a green buffer space, and more parking were needed for a new facility. The housing element needs to be screened from view from nosy neighbors, especially in the residences where transgender youth live (this has been a problem in the past). The managers also expressed that the outdoor spaces for sunbathing, playing volleyball, and barbecuing are popular, and those should be incorporated into the semi-public spaces in the project. Gardens and p-patchs were also desired.
What issues do you have at your facility related to security and visibility? What are ways to mitigate that?Need to have offices or staff areas that look onto common space for the youth, like the Orion Center has windows that look into the main room from the upstairs offices, creating a visual connection. Stairwells and hallways, and bathrooms, are often places that are unmonitored where bullying occurs, so making those spaces more open and visible would help prevent some of the intimidation among the youth and make them feel more safe and secure. While they need privacy from the neighbors, they also need to be friends with the neighbors - the idea that the more eyes on the street, the more secure it will be.

One site selected for the project was chosen as an urban typology with easy access to downtown. Downtown was viewed as both an asset and a potential detriment to the well-being of the youth. This corner site is located on the corner of 17th Avenue and East Yesler Way. It is approximately 15,500 square feet and zoned for Neighborhood Commercial and a 40 foot height limit. Currently, the site is a vacated auto shop.
Also, this site is adjacent to the Langston Hughes Performing Arts Center, a small commercial area, a vocational school, and
East Yesler Way
17th Avenue
Studio
a public park. The closest transit routes for the site include the following bus lines: 14, 27, 984, 987.

This site was selected for the project for the purposes of exploring a large site in South Seattle. This corner site is located at the intersection of South Alaska Street and Martin Luther King Jr. Way South. It is approximately 30,000 square feet and zoned for Neighborhood Commercial and a 40 foot height limit. The site is in a small mixed-use area surrounded by the Rainier Vista affordable housing development and single family homes.
Previously, the site included a gas station, resulting in the
ongoing remediation of the site’s soil. The closest transit options include the Columbia City light rail station across the street and the 8, 9, and 42 bus lines.

When the UW Architects Without Borders - YouthCare Studio was first organized with the intent of serving the non-profit organization YouthCare, we set out to provide them with both a short-term design/build solution as well as a long-term architectural visioning study to help them expand their services and capabilities as an organization serving the homeless youth in Seattle.
http://blog.endhomelessness.org Milk Crates - Repurposing of Materials Modularity of Shelving Units
To achieve our short-term design/build solution, the YouthCare studio discussed the needs of the organization with both the staff and the youth served by YouthCare, and were given the opportunity to design a much-needed storage solution for the YouthCare’s Orion Center located in Downtown Seattle.
The concept for the storage system consisted of four main aspirations: repurposing of materials, replicability and ease of construction, modularity and low-cost. While touring the Orion Center, the team was inspired by the reusing of empty milk-crates as storage boxes. Using this concept of designing with repurposed materials, the design team was able to propose a relatively low-cost storage solution using empty milk crates.

The extensive program and small site led us to start with the buildable envelope. We experimented with strategically eroding the building based on solar access and a simple building parti. After many iterations, a lower plinth supporting an “L” above became the basic massing. The plinth houses the learning program, the “L” contains housing.
From here we developed a diagram that organized the relationships inside the building, the movement of people and the systems that support the people. The initial diagram is about activated edges. In a natural system, edges are the most active and diverse areas. In buildings, edges are often closed, sealed, or detailed to reduce activity and movement. By pulling apart the edges where two things meet, a space forms. We filled these spaces with circulation, daylight, active HVAC and water systems. This proved to be a powerful and practical idea.

This project began with the team placing priority on the role of this new living and learning building in the context of YouthCare’s existing facilities. The role imagined for the new building was that it would act as a gathering place at the scale of the city, the valley, and Columbia City. At each scale, homeless youth are using the living and learning program as a common point of transition to and from other YouthCare facilities and different levels of independence.
Thus, the program and conceptual framework for the project reflect the basic massing of the project. The massing is based on a programmatic block of living, another of learning, and then a space in between that acts as a place of transition. This place transitions the youth programmatically from living to learning spaces and experientially from the more public experience of the street to the more private experience of the residences.

The final form of the building strongly reflects the conceptual intent. Classrooms, a community partnership space, a YouthBuild workshop, and conference room comprise the ground floor of the learning block, with staff office space above. A commercial teaching kitchen and community garden anchor the southern tip of the living block, functioning as a learning space, while a dining space above the kitchen functions as a related living space for the residents.
The living block is broken down into four levels of housing. Each level, the layout changes to reflect an increasing sense of independence. The ground floor includes dormitory-style rooms that use the common kitchen and shared bathrooms. The floor above houses units with a shared kitchen and bath in a group of four individual rooms. The upper two floors are studio apartments, each with their own kitchen and bath.
